16 """This script uses T-REX stateless API to drive t-rex instance.
19 - T-REX: https://github.com/cisco-system-traffic-generator/trex-core
20 - compiled and running T-REX process (eg. ./t-rex-64 -i)
21 - trex.stl.api library
22 - Script must be executed on a node with T-REX instance
25 1. Stop any running traffic
